Here's a modified version, it uses a towball to eliminate strain on the suspension, though when it travels upwards, the camber angle will change, because of the distance between the upper link to stabilize the suspension.

Ldd file here http://www.bricksafe... suspension.lxf

I think it needs a second link below the axle to prevent flex of the axle.
